Transaction 1214289edcdc0559ae115926bb934854ce2428ae9f05767df6673c05792a1611

1 Input
2 Outputs
  • 1214289edcdc0559ae115926bb934854ce2428ae9f05767df6673c05792a1611:0
  • value  70938883722
    address  2N93nXfdBet29vrbxQKB3yvhykTBpPcPcmy
  • 1214289edcdc0559ae115926bb934854ce2428ae9f05767df6673c05792a1611:1
  • value  1742061
    address  2NBnkJGx9gaiVSBEHdS81fRGntAoh13mTEB